Combined extracorporeal shock wave lithotripsy and percutaneous alkalinization in uric acid calculi.

H Vandeursen1, G Pittomvils, L Baert.   

Abstract

The combination of percutaneous alkaline irrigation and lithotripsy was performed in 5 cases of uric acid calculi obstructing the ureter. Shock wave lithotripsy accelerates the dissolution of uric acid stones.
